This vibrant spot offers an upscale, hipster vibe with dim lighting and murals that create a unique atmosphere. The spacious outdoor patio invites gatherings, and the venue is known for being celiac friendly with clearly marked gluten-free options and sensitivity to cross-contamination, making it a great choice for gluten-free diners.

My first food stop in Iowa was to take a solo walk to get tacos at Malo. This one was a home run at my first at-bat as a Des Moines rookie. Wow. I timed it just right, and they were placing my bag of food on the table right as I walked in the door. I got the avocado and fried onions on corn tortillas, and instead of getting a combo, I got the portobello mushrooms as my side. That way I was able to just put them on my tacos. I also got a side of fruit with sweet chili sauce. It didn't want to have anything super spicy before my marathon (think about it) so I got the pico de gallo. The tacos were delicious, and the fresh tortillas seemed handmade. The fruit was so juicy and sweet, but the stunner here was the portobello mushroom - like steak strips. Savory and meaty but not too salty... Just amazing. I had enough left over for a second meal. Great vegan and gluten-free options.

Great service, inventive cocktails, and well-crafted Latin comfort food. I've always had a good time here. They mark gluten free items on their menu, too, and are sensitive to shared fryer oil. I told my girl friend I love her here--not necessarily a relevant critique, but a charming aside.
